Definitions from Wiktionary (Florentine)
▸ adjective: Cooked or served with spinach.
▸ noun: A biscuit consisting mostly of nuts and preserved fruit, usually coated with chocolate on one side.
▸ noun: (obsolete) A kind of durable silk.
▸ noun: (obsolete) A kind of pudding or tart or meat pie.
▸ adjective: Of or relating to the Italian city of Florence.
▸ noun: A native or resident of the Italian city of Florence.
▸ noun: (cooking) Alternative form of florentine (“biscuit”) [A biscuit consisting mostly of nuts and preserved fruit, usually coated with chocolate on one side.]
